App introduction

A lightweight Android chatbot app for quick answers, translation help, and casual AI support.

The Google Play listing positions Chat AI as a mobile-first chat assistant that can answer questions, look up information, and help with everyday problem solving.

Its most concrete differentiator is multilingual support across 140+ languages, which makes it useful as both a chat helper and a quick language bridge when you need one.

Because the listing is broad and the app is ad-supported with in-app purchases, it reads more like an entry point to mobile AI than a tightly specialized productivity tool.

Core featuresCore features

  • Natural chatNatural chat: Uses natural-language prompting so you can ask follow-up questions the way you would in a conversation.
  • Instant answersInstant answers: Promises quick responses to questions across everyday topics, from facts and history to pop culture.
  • Multilingual supportMultilingual support: The listing says the app supports more than 140 languages and can help with translation or language practice.
  • Personalized repliesPersonalized replies: The page says the assistant can learn from interactions and adapt responses over time.

Frequently asked questions

Is Chat AI free?

Yes, but the Play listing shows ads and in-app purchases.

How many languages does it support?

The listing says it supports 140+ languages.

Does it do more than chat?

Yes. The page also claims translation help and broad Q&A support.

What should I check before installing?

Ads, permissions, privacy details, and whether its answers are accurate enough for you.
